Probably the most ridiculous statement with regard to Richt!

Now, does anybody know what next year will bring? No. But, think about this and I don't think many posters, here, will disagree.

Based on his past 15 years of in the SEC, his past experience, record in the SEC and just 3 facts, of many,
below, it's much more likely Richt would have beaten both Cincinnati and fsu this season. That's a 10 win
season with a bowl game to play.

Facts:

1) 75% wins in the SEC
2) Of all the coaches out there with a 15 year record or more, only
3 (2 in HOF and 1 will be) coaches are better. Stoops, Switzer and Osborn.
3) When Richt was totally hands on (how his will coach here) his W/L record
is excellent, including 2 out 3 SEC championships.

Combing the above facts with the fact that our O-Line had less reps than 122 of the 128 schools in
the FBS at the seasons start actually have a seasons worth experience and tape of all their mistakes
for Richt and Kehoe to study and fix.

Yes, we will lose some great players to the draft. But, if you haven't noticed each recruiting class
has be producing more high quality players, not less. This will be a positive.

In conclusion, it's my opinion we have a much better chance of winning 10 games next year then we do
of losing 6 games.

In fact, I believe even with the loss of talent we will have a better record and overall season next year
than this year.
